免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app外包开发动态

在互联网行业,很多公司或个人想要开发一个自己的移动应用程序(App),但是由于技术或资源等方面的限制,他们往往选择外包开发来实现他们的想法。本篇文章将详细介绍App外包开发的原理和流程,帮助读者了解这个过程以及如何选择合适的外包合作伙伴。

一、什么是App外包开发

App外包开发指的是将移动应用程序的开发工作委外给其他公司或个人完成。这些外包团队通常具有丰富的技术经验和开发资源,能够在较短的时间内完成高质量的应用程序。

二、App外包开发的原理

1. 需求评估和功能规划

首先,外包团队会与委托方进行需求沟通,了解他们的期望和目标。然后,根据需求评估现有资源和团队能力,制定功能规划和开发路线图。

2. UI/UX设计

外包团队会根据委托方的要求和行业最佳实践进行用户界面(UI)和用户体验(UX)设计。这一步骤旨在为用户提供优雅、易用且符合品牌形象的界面。

3. 开发

外包团队会采用合适的开发技术和工具,根据功能规划开始编码开发。他们可能使用多种编程语言和框架,如Java、Swift、React Native等。

4. 测试和优化

开发完成后,外包团队会进行全面测试,并修复可能存在的技术债务和漏洞。他们还将根据用户反馈和测试结果进行优化和改进,确保应用程序的质量和性能。

5. 发布和支持

一旦应用程序开发和测试完成,外包团队将协助委托方将其发布到各个应用商店或平台。他们可能还提供应用程序的后续维护和支持服务,以确保应用程序的正常运行。

三、App外包开发的流程

下面是一个典型的App外包开发流程:

1. 需求分析和规划:明确委托方的需求和目标,并制定详细的开发计划。

2. 筛选外包合作伙伴:寻找有丰富经验和良好声誉的外包团队,并对他们的能力和成果进行评估。

3. 合同和讨论:与外包团队达成合作协议,并讨论具体的项目要求和约定。

4. 设计和开发:外包团队开始进行UI/UX设计和应用程序开发。

5. 测试和优化:对应用程序进行全面的测试,并根据测试结果进行优化和改进。

6. 发布和支持:协助委托方将应用程序发布到应用商店,并提供后续的维护和支持服务。

四、如何选择合适的外包合作伙伴

1. 评估他们的技术能力:了解外包团队的技术专长、开发经验和项目案例。

2. 了解他们的工作流程:了解他们的项目管理方法、设计流程和质量保证措施。

3. 考虑他们的沟通与配合:确保外包团队能够与委托方保持良好的沟通并配合工作。

4. 评估他们的口碑和信誉:查看他们的客户评价和案例,了解他们的口碑和信誉。

5. 确认他们的合作模式:了解他们的合作模式,例如是固定报价还是按小时计费等。

总结:

App外包开发是一种常见的方式,可以帮助企业或个人实现其移动应用程序的想法。选择合适的外包合作伙伴非常重要,可以通过评估其技术能力、工作流程、沟通与配合、口碑和信誉来做出决策。希望本文能够帮助读者更好地了解App外包开发的原理和流程,以便做出明智的决策。


相关知识:
山东app模板开发报价
山东app模板开发报价是根据客户需求进行定制化开发的,因此报价会有所差异。以下是一些原理和详细介绍,可以帮助客户更好地了解山东app模板开发及其报价。一、山东app模板开发原理1.需求分析:在开发过程中,首先需要进行需求分析,确定客户的需求和期望。这将有助
2024-01-10
如何开发购物app
购物App已经成为了现代人购物的主要方式之一,随着移动互联网技术的不断发展,购物App的用户数量也在不断增加。开发购物App需要了解相关技术和流程,本文将介绍购物App的开发原理和详细步骤。一、购物App开发原理购物App的开发原理主要包括以下几个方面:1
2024-01-10
app移动端接口开发
移动端接口开发是指开发用于移动应用程序与后端服务器进行数据交互的接口。在移动应用程序中,接口起到了连接前端界面和后端数据之间的桥梁作用,负责传递数据请求和返回数据结果。接口开发的主要步骤包括设计接口规范、实现接口逻辑和测试接口功能。下面将详细介绍每个步骤的
2023-07-14
app开发中经常犯的一些错误
在app开发过程中,开发人员常常会犯一些错误。这些错误可能会导致应用程序的性能下降、安全性问题、用户体验不佳等等。下面是一些常见的错误以及它们的解决方法:1. 内存泄漏:内存泄漏是指应用程序中未释放的内存占用。这可能会导致应用程序变得缓慢,甚至崩溃。解决内
2023-06-29
app开发行业
总体介绍随着智能手机和平板电脑的普及,移动应用程序(app)开发也成为了越来越热门的领域。尽管这个行业尚属于相对较新的行业,但它已经有了国际化的影响力和发展速度。app开发行业是一个真正的多领域的综合领域。它涉及很多科学和技术领域,如计算机科学、软件工程、
2023-06-29
app bundle 开发
App Bundle 是 Google 推出的一种 Android 应用分发格式,其可以优化应用程序的大小和安装的时效性。这种格式可以在应用程序打包和发布的时候为不同的设备和配置版本生成定制和最优化的 APK。App Bundle 是一种由 Android
2023-05-06